The composition of the pavement material greatly determines the quality of the asphalt pavement mixture, considering that marble waste from marble stone processing in Gamping Village, Campurdarat District, Tulungagung Regency is not used as a building material, therefore this study aims to determine whether marble waste is suitable for use as a substitute for mountain rock aggregates. or black stone as a mixture of asphalt pavement. And what percentage of the recommended amount of marble waste is used. Based on previous research, it is known that marble stone waste has characteristics as a substitute for coarse aggregate, this study aims to determine the content of marble stone waste as a substitute for coarse aggregate 10/10 in the ATB layer, by examining its levels. marble waste 25%, 50%, 75% and 100%. From the results of the research conducted, it is found that: (1) Aggregates meet specifications and are suitable for use as a mixture of road pavements. (2) Marble stone waste as a material from coarse aggregate 10/10 on the ATB layer has an effect or gives a significant difference. This can be seen from the test results, where Fcount> Ftable. The stability value at 0% marble content was 1048.56 kg and at 100% marble content was 938.32 kg. the expected criteria value in the mix of limits set by the 2018 Highways Agency such as the value of stability, flow, VIM, VMA, VFA and MQ.
